Additional adoption info
Safe Haven Animal Rescue Program (SHARP) is based in rural Polk County Tennessee. We have no shelter or animal control in our county. Currently we are the only 501C3 non-profit in the county. We advertise our animals out of state ,which gives them better odds of a happy long life.
Our dogs and cats are fostered in TN with loving families. You will have the opportunity to speak with the foster of the animal you are interested in. All our Cats and Dogs are completely vetted ,which includes spay/neuter, vaccinations , microchipped (dogs only)and heartworm testing (dogs) . All of them come with complete medical records ,which travel with them. Their adoption fee covers a health certificate from the vet and transport fee.
Our rescue doesn't have an actual shelter building in the Michigan area. Due to this it is not possible to meet them prior to their adoption. Our dogs and cats are transported up to their new owner’s biweekly! We have a 14 day no questions asked money back guarantee and the dog/cats can be returned to us if things don't work out. We try hard to get good matches in our homes so that everyone has a happy life together! To date we have placed over a thousand dogs and cats in loving homes!
